How they compare
Saint Lucia currently reports 58,770 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re against 2,460 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re in Sub-Saharan Africa (excluding high income), a difference of 56,310 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re.
That makes Saint Lucia's figure about 23.9 times Sub-Saharan Africa (excluding high income)'s.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 49 shared years of data; in 1973 it was Saint Lucia ahead.
Saint Lucia ranks 19th and Sub-Saharan Africa (excluding high income) ranks 17th of 178 countries.
Saint Lucia has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Saint Lucia | Sub-Saharan Africa (excluding high income) |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 34,586 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 627.11 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 33,959 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| Saint Lucia |
| 1980s | 39,713 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 1,090 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 38,623 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| Saint Lucia |
| 1990s | 61,364 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 1,123 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 60,241 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| Saint Lucia |
| 2000s | 31,930 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 1,572 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 30,358 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| Saint Lucia |
| 2010s | 38,078 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 2,052 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 36,026 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| Saint Lucia |
| 2020s | 168,861 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 2,629 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| 166,232 constant 2023 US$ per square kilometre | Saint Lucia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Net official development assistance and official aid received (constant 2023 US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
